This course covers the role of pharmaceuticals in the prevention and treatment of illness from an individual and societal perspective. Emphasis is placed on subjects in the field of social pharmacy and medicine epidemiology.
The course focuses on users of pharmaceuticals in different phases of life and with different illnesses, particularly on individually adapted follow-up and information on correct use of pharmaceuticals. The general subject matter is examined from a societal perspective in relation to medication and medicalisation of different life situations and groups of illnesses. Statistical concepts, epidemiology and critical assessment of articles are also covered in the course.

Course description
Subjects covered by the course, with credits specified:
- Social pharmacy (4 ECTS)
- Epidemiology (3 ECTS)
- Statistics (3 ECTS)
